The human attention span is shorter than ever. Creators making "Hindi originals shorts" have mastered the art of hook-and-payoff. Within the first 3 seconds, the conflict is established, and by the 15th second, the first major punchline lands. This rapid pacing makes it nearly impossible to swipe away.
